Output 3effc24b30a0851b75993ab78ac0c7ea27327e4b2dae38f258faecc8c7535e5f:0

value
596319
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f7539a59165301d74e3e46f3c36733f635fa1f3 OP_EQUAL
address
3EmYyvYXjsZmJ8Hk6ieFW1iQGcCx5JaZck
transaction
3effc24b30a0851b75993ab78ac0c7ea27327e4b2dae38f258faecc8c7535e5f
spent
true